Unveiling the Mechanisms of Ganoderma's Wellness Benefits
For centuries, Ganoderma lucidum, commonly known as Mushroom of Immortality, has been revered in traditional Asian medicine for its purported health boosting effects. Recent scientific research is now beginning to shed light on the mechanisms contributing these alleged benefits. Ganoderma contains a rich blend of bioactive compounds, including triterpenoids, polysaccharides, and proteins, each with individual properties that contribute to its overall health-promoting effect.
Research have shown that Ganoderma extract can exert a variety of beneficial effects on the body, including reducing inflammation, enhancing memory and focus, and supporting cardiovascular health. The exact mechanisms by which Ganoderma exerts these effects are still under study, but it is believed that its bioactive compounds interact with various signaling pathways within the body.
